Why Choose a Japanese Free Course?
Choosing a Japanese free course is an excellent starting point for beginners and intermediate learners alike. These courses provide structured lessons without financial commitment, allowing learners to explore the language at their own pace. Here are some advantages of selecting a free course:
- Cost-Effective: No financial barrier allows learners to experiment with different methods and materials.
- Accessible: Available online anytime, making it convenient for busy schedules.
- Variety of Learning Materials: Includes videos, audio, quizzes, and interactive exercises to cater to different learning styles.
- Low Pressure: Enables learners to study without the stress of deadlines or exams.
Many Japanese free courses cover essential topics like Hiragana, Katakana, basic grammar, vocabulary, and conversational phrases, providing a solid foundation for further study.
Key Features of an Effective Japanese Free Course
Not all free courses are created equal. When searching for the best Japanese free course, consider the following features to ensure a comprehensive learning experience:
Structured Curriculum
A well-organized syllabus guides learners progressively through language components such as writing systems, grammar points, vocabulary, and pronunciation. This helps build confidence and prevents overwhelm.
Interactive Practice
Exercises that encourage active engagement—such as quizzes, flashcards, and speaking drills—boost retention and improve practical skills. Look for courses that incorporate multimedia elements and instant feedback.
Cultural Insights
Understanding Japanese culture enriches language learning by providing context. Courses that include cultural notes, etiquette tips, and real-life scenarios enhance motivation and comprehension.
Community Support
Opportunities to connect with fellow learners or native speakers through forums or chat groups foster a supportive learning environment. Community interaction can improve conversational skills and provide encouragement.

Popular Japanese Free Courses to Get Started
Here are some well-regarded Japanese free courses that can complement your Talkpal practice:
- NHK World Easy Japanese: Offers audio lessons with transcripts focusing on everyday conversations.
- JapanesePod101: Provides a wide range of free video and audio lessons covering vocabulary, grammar, and culture.
- Tofugu: A popular blog and resource site with detailed guides on learning Japanese, especially the writing systems.
- Duolingo Japanese: An interactive app-based course ideal for beginners to build basic vocabulary and grammar skills.
- Memrise Japanese: Uses spaced repetition and mnemonic techniques to help memorize words and phrases effectively.
